About the Company
Ingfield Manor School is a non-maintained special school and part of Salutem Care and Education who have services across England and Wales supporting adults and children in residential and educational environments. Based in our idyllic grounds, Ingfield Manor School offers extensive specialist facilities with the aim to provide an exceptional learning environment, helping children and young people fulfil their potential. Facilities include woodland and outdoor classroom space, high specification sensory room and swimming pool. At Ingfield Manor School, we believe everyone should have the opportunity to live a healthy, active, and fulfilling life, regardless of their background or disability. The aim of our services is to provide a safe and stimulating environment that enables children and young people to flourish and grow.
About the Role
Location: Ingfield Manor School, West Sussex
Salary: £32,500 – £38,000 (Term Time Only) (FT 52wks £37,892 - £44,305)
Contract: Permanent, 40 hours per week, Term Time Only (39 weeks)
Ingfield Manor School, part of Salutem Care and Education, is seeking an enthusiastic, committed, and skilled Conductor to join our outstanding team. This is a unique and rewarding opportunity to make a meaningful impact on the lives of children and young people with neurological motor impairments and associated needs.
Responsibilities
- As a Conductor, you will play a pivotal role in developing and delivering Conductive Education practice across a department as part of a transdisciplinary team.
- Lead and implement Conductive Education programmes
- Promote functional independence and support pupils' holistic development
- Plan and deliver group and individual learning sessions
- Monitor and assess pupil progress
- Create dynamic, engaging learning environments
- Collaborate with a wide range of professionals and families
- Provide high standards of physical and emotional care, including intimate care
- Contribute to annual reviews, planning, and whole-school development
Qualifications
- A Qualified Conductor
- Experienced in working with children and young people within a Conductive Education setting
- Skilled in collaborative, multidisciplinary practice
- A strong communicator with excellent organisational skills
- Adaptable, empathetic, enthusiastic, and committed to delivering outstanding practice
